Electrochemical grinding - Wikipedia
One of the key advantages of electrochemical grinding is the minimal wear that the grinding wheel tool experiences. This is because the majority of the material is removed by the electrochemical reaction that occurs between the cathode and anode. The only time that abrasive grinding actually occurs is in removing the film that develops on the surface of the workpiece. 27/07/2020 In electrochemical grinding (ECG), the workpiece becomes an anode and the grinding wheel becomes a cathode, removing material from the workpiece both electrochemically and mechanically. Electrochemical machining is an electrolytic operation where the workpiece becomes an anode and the cutting tool (in the case of ECG, a grinding wheel) becomes the cathode.

ECG combines abrasive grinding with electrochemical machining to provide stress-free, low force, and burr-free cuts. Used extensively for medical and aerospace applications to cut high-temperature alloys, stainless-steels, and materials that are difficult to machine. Typical applications include needles, fasteners, and tube cutoff.

ELECTROCHEMICAL GRINDING: Meaning, Considerations
04/03/2021 MEANING. Electrochemical grinding is a cycle that eliminates electrically conductive material by grinding with an negatively charged abrasive grinding wheel, an electrolyte liquid, and a positively charged workpiece.. Materials eliminated from the workpiece stay in the electrolyte liquid. Electrochemical grinding (ECG) joins electrochemical machining with regular grinding.

What You Need To Know About Electrochemical
Electrochemical Grinding Equipment. Either a professional level electrochemical machine or, through the use of a lathe or conventional grinding machine, a modified machine can be used for electrochemical grinding. Electrochemical Grinding(ECG) - BrainKart
Quality Electrochemical Grinding (ECG) machines must also be rigid for close tolerance results but since very little of the material removed is done so abrasively the machines do not have to be as massive as their conventional counterparts. The Complexities of Electrochemical Grinding - Metal ...
22/01/2019 There is no good reason to use an electrochemical grinding machine for its surface grinding aspect alone. For instance, you’d never use it to achieve surface finish and parallelism on a block of metal, since the electrochemical process would basically erode the block. Electrochemical Machining - Selbach Machinery L.L.C.
Electrochemical machining (ECM) is a method of removing metal by an electrochemical process. It is normally used for mass production and is used for working extremely hard materials or materials that are difficult to machine using conventional methods.
